Abstract

A loudspeaker is described. The loudspeaker includes two or more segmentations of a planar radiator. Each of the segmentations has an associated frequency dependent velocity magnitude and phase with substantially uniform surface pressure. The two or more segmentations provide a substantially uniform radiation pattern across a wide range of acoustic frequencies. Apparatus, computer readable media and methods are also described.

Claims (32)

1. An apparatus comprising:

a plurality of segmentations of a planar radiator,

wherein each segmentation of the plurality of segmentations has an associated frequency dependent velocity magnitude and phase with substantially uniform surface pressure and provides a substantially uniform radiation pattern across a range of acoustic frequencies, and wherein the plurality of segmentations comprise:

a plurality of axially symmetric concentric rings of electrode pairs having a membrane disposed between members of each electrode pair, each member of electrode pairs being driven by a respective bridge amplifier having anti-phase outputs.

2. The apparatus of claim 1 , wherein an input electric signal is amplified by a first bridge amplifier and applied to a centermost electrode pair, and wherein each successive bridge amplifier is coupled to an output of a phase delay element of a plurality of serially connected phase delay elements, such that the input electric signal is delayed from the centermost electrode pair towards an electrode pair disposed at a periphery of the concentric rings of electrode pairs.

3. The apparatus of claim 1 , wherein the plurality of bridge amplifiers and phase delay elements are embodied in at least one integrated circuit chip or module.

4. The apparatus of claim 1 , embodied as an electret loudspeaker, wherein the membrane contains a polarizing charge.

5. The apparatus of claim 1 , embodied as an electrostatic loudspeaker, wherein the membrane comprises a conductive coating connected to a voltage source.

6. The apparatus of claim 1 , wherein the apparatus is embodied in a dipole loudspeaker.

7. The apparatus of claim 1 , wherein the segmentations are one of: striped, circular, elliptical, rectangular and square in shape.

8. The apparatus of claim 1 , embodied as one of: an electret, an electrostatic, an electrodynamic and a piezoelectric loudspeaker.

9. The apparatus of claim 1 , wherein the plurality of segmentations comprise at least three segmentations and the width of each of the at least three segmentations is less than a wavelength of the acoustic frequencies.

10. The apparatus of claim 1 , wherein the acoustic frequencies are within a frequency range of 150 Hz to 20 kHz.

11. An apparatus comprising:

a plurality of segmentations of a planar radiator,

wherein each segmentation of the plurality of segmentations has an associated frequency dependent velocity magnitude and phase with substantially uniform surface pressure and provides a substantially uniform radiation pattern across a range of acoustic frequencies,

wherein the plurality of segmentations comprise a plurality of concentric rings of electrode pairs having a membrane disposed between members of each electrode pair, and

further comprising at least one amplifier configured to drive each member of an electrode pair, and a plurality of phase delay elements,

wherein an electric signal applied to each of the electrode pairs is delayed from the centermost electrode pair towards an electrode pair disposed at a periphery of the concentric rings of electrode pairs.

12. The apparatus of claim 11 , wherein there is a multi-way cross-over network comprising the plurality of phase delay elements connected between an output of an amplifier and the concentric rings of electrode pairs.

13. The apparatus of claim 11 , wherein the rings are one of circular, or elliptical, or rectangular, or square in shape.

14. The apparatus of claim 11 , embodied as an electret loudspeaker, wherein the membrane contains a polarizing charge.

15. The apparatus of claim 11 , embodied as an electrostatic loudspeaker, wherein the membrane comprises a conductive coating connected to a voltage source.

16. The apparatus of claim 11 , embodied in one of: a dipole loudspeaker and a monopole loudspeaker.

17. The apparatus of claim 11 , embodied as one of: an electret, an electrostatic, an electrodynamic and a piezoelectric loudspeaker.

18. A method comprising:

providing a loudspeaker having an segmentation of a planar radiator,

wherein each segmentation is configured to exhibit an associated frequency dependent velocity magnitude and phase with substantially uniform surface pressure and to provide a substantially uniform radiation pattern across a range of acoustic frequencies,

wherein the segmentation is comprised of a plurality of concentric rings of electrode pairs having a membrane disposed between members of each electrode pair; and

exciting each member of an electrode pair with an electric signal that is applied to each the electrode pairs,

wherein exciting comprises delaying the electric signal from a centermost electrode pair towards an electrode pair disposed at a periphery of the concentric rings of electrode pairs.

19. The method of claim 18 , wherein the rings are one of circular, or elliptical, or rectangular, or square in shape.
